Output 7521fcc3660908bfc18f39ae5fcfc3e9e135f4b256d1aceb7c247a3b0e464f3a:31

value
110000
script pubkey
OP_0 OP_PUSHBYTES_20 505c658bed0fe07134e00f7f0709f5b073d56502
address
bc1q2pwxtzldpls8zd8qpalswz04kpea2egzsljkds
transaction
7521fcc3660908bfc18f39ae5fcfc3e9e135f4b256d1aceb7c247a3b0e464f3a
spent
true